Latest Patents

Duncan's latest patents showcase innovative solutions to challenges in optical sensing. One of his notable inventions is an optical sensor with a movable refraction element designed to adjust the sensor range. This advanced optical sensor incorporates a light source that projects light onto an object, while a photodetector captures the light reflected from that object. By allowing the refraction element to move relative to the photodetector, the range of the sensor can be varied effectively. Additionally, the positioning of the light source could be altered concerning the photodetector, enhancing flexibility in application.

Another significant invention by Duncan is the Photoelectric Color Sensor. This technology employs at least one pair of light-emitting diodes (LEDs) that direct common discrete beams of chromaticity to separate target areas located at different distances from a centrally placed photodetector. This configuration is designed to minimize the effects of distance variation on target detection, producing more accurate readings. Furthermore, the photodetector output can be adjusted to account for ambient temperature changes affecting the LEDs.
